Novel power line buckling sleeve
By designing a soft silicone power cord snap sleeve, combined with an organic silicone pressure-sensitive adhesive and a graphene protective layer, the problems of high hardness, moisture absorption, and poor sealing of the power cord snap sleeve are solved, thus improving the durability and waterproof performance of the power cord.

[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of fastening sleeves, specifically to a novel power cord fastening sleeve. Background Technology
[0002] Power cord protectors are protective sleeves used at the connection points of electrical wires. Their main function is to prevent damage and short circuits, while also enhancing the appearance of the connection and improving the overall aesthetics. Power cord protectors on the market come in various styles, but are mostly made of a single material: plastic. This limitation makes them susceptible to the limitations of plastic products, which also have several drawbacks: plastic is relatively hard and easily damages the power cord; it is prone to moisture absorption, affecting the electrical properties of the power cord; some plastic products do not provide a good seal; and they are easily damaged, affecting their durability.
[0003] Therefore, the existing technology for snap-fit sleeves needs further design.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to overcome the shortcomings of existing snap-fit sleeves, such as stiffness, easy damage to power cords, susceptibility to moisture affecting the electrical properties of power cords, poor sealing, easy breakage, and lack of durability. By rationally designing the snap-fit sleeve technology and incorporating a handle, cover, cover through-h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, stabilizer, and toughening layer, the snap-fit sleeve can be made flexible, less prone to damaging power cords, waterproof, and has good toughness and durability.
[0005] The specific technical solution of this utility model is as follows:
[0006] A novel power cord fastening sleeve includes: a handle, a cover, a cover through-hole, a cover stabilizer, a connector, a tube, a stabilizer, and a toughening layer. The handle is mounted on the cover. The cover through-hole is located within the cover, and the center line of the cover through-hole coincides with the center line of the cover. The cover through-hole penetrates the cover. The cover stabilizer is located on the cover through-hole and is connected to the cover. One end of the connector is connected to the cover, and the other end of the connector is connected to the tube. The stabilizer is located on the inner cavity of the tube and is used to stabilize external objects entering the inner cavity of the tube. The toughening layer is provided on the handle, cover, cover through-h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, and stabilizer.
[0007] Furthermore, the handle, cover, cover through h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, and stabilizer are all made of silicone.
[0008] Furthermore, the handle, cover, cover through h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, and stabilizer are integrally formed.
[0009] Furthermore, the handle may be cylindrical, elliptical, prismatic, or inverted "L" shaped.
[0010] Furthermore, the tube body includes a groove, a cylindrical tube, and a frustum tube. One end of the cylindrical tube is connected to the connector, and the other end of the cylindrical tube is connected to the frustum tube. The larger end of the frustum tube is connected to the other end of the cylindrical tube, and the groove is disposed on the outer surface of the cylindrical tube.
[0011] Furthermore, the groove, cylindrical tube, and frustum tube are integrally formed.
[0012] Furthermore, the groove is selected as an annular groove, which can be used to snap onto external objects.
[0013] Furthermore, the stable component is provided inside the smaller end of the frustum tube.
[0014] Furthermore, the stabilizer is a disc with a cross-shaped notch in the center.
[0015] Furthermore, the cover stabilizer is selected as a disc with a cross-shaped notch in the center.
[0016] Furthermore, the cover body includes a convex cover and a cover tube, the convex cover is disposed at one end of the cover tube, the other end of the cover tube is provided with the cover stabilizer, and the connector connects to the convex cover.
[0017] Furthermore, the convex cap and the cap tube are integrally formed.
[0018] Furthermore, the outer diameter of the cover tube is equal to the inner diameter of the cylindrical tube.
[0019] Furthermore, the cover is fastened onto the tube.
[0020] Furthermore, the handle and the cover tube are respectively disposed on both sides of the convex cover.
[0021] Furthermore, the toughening layer includes an adhesive layer, a toughening layer, and a protective layer. The adhesive layer is disposed on the handle, cover, cover through h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, and stabilizer. The toughening layer is disposed on the adhesive layer, and the protective layer is disposed on the toughening layer.
[0022] Furthermore, the adhesive layer is selected as an adhesive layer of silicone pressure-sensitive adhesive.
[0023] Furthermore, the adhesive layer is applied using a spraying technique to deposit an organosilicon pressure-sensitive adhesive onto the handle, cover, cover through-h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, and stabilizer.
[0024] Furthermore, the toughening layer is selected as a toughening layer of silane-modified polyurethane.
[0025] Furthermore, the toughening layer is constructed by depositing silane-modified polyurethane onto the adhesive layer using a spraying technique.
[0026] Furthermore, the protective layer is selected as a graphene protective layer.
[0027] Furthermore, the protective layer uses magnetron sputtering technology to deposit graphene onto the toughened layer.
[0028] Beneficial effects
[0029] This utility model, through a rational design of the fastening sleeve, employs a handle, cover, cover through-hole, cover stabilizer, connector, tube, stabilizer, and toughening layer. This results in a flexible fastening sleeve that is less prone to damaging the power cord, offers waterproofing, good toughness, and excellent durability. The cover stabilizer and stabilizer ensure stability of the power cord and a better seal at the power cord interface. The connector facilitates the fastening and opening of the cover and tube, protecting the power cord interface. The handle and cover work together to allow for easy opening and fastening of the cover. The use of an adhesive layer of silicone pressure-sensitive adhesive, a toughening layer of silane-modified polyurethane, and a graphene protective layer enhances the fastening sleeve's toughness and reduces its susceptibility to damage. [0042] The specific implementation method of this utility model is as follows: To manufacture the fastening sleeve, liquid silicone is injected into the mold through an injection mold to form the fastening sleeve. A 300μm thick layer of silicone pressure-sensitive adhesive is sprayed onto the surface of the fastening sleeve. A 100μm thick layer of silane-modified polyurethane is deposited on the silicone pressure-sensitive adhesive layer by spraying technology. Then, graphene is deposited on the toughening layer by magnetron sputtering technology to form a graphene layer of about 100μm thickness, thus preparing the final fastening sleeve.
